Wildfires near Kyaka II Refugee Camp

UgandaNASA FIRMS (VIIRS)

Recorded by satellite today.

A thermal anomaly is a snapshot of one satellite pass, not a record of a fire’s life: we cannot say whether it kept burning after that pass.

No stronger detection stands among the 12 recorded within 20 km of this point since 29 June 2026 — 3 others scored the same. Another comparable one was recorded here earlier the same day.

What the source measured

NASA FIRMS (VIIRS) reported 53 fire pixels with a combined fire radiative power of 367 MW, at nominal confidence, 7 km from Kyaka II Refugee Camp.

The 53 pixels cover about 7.4 km² — that is the footprint of the detection grid at 375 m resolution, not an estimate of how much land burned.

FIRMS does not report burned area, and neither do we.

An estimated 85,253 people live within 50 km of this point.

Safety Information

If a wildfire is approaching: follow evacuation orders immediately. Do not wait to see the fire. Close all windows and doors, remove combustible materials from around your home, and have an emergency go-bag ready. Air quality can deteriorate rapidly even at distance from the fire front — monitor local air quality advisories.
